This serif face shows pronounced stroke contrast with a clear vertical stress and sharply tapered hairlines against weighty main stems. Serifs are bracketed and slightly flared, giving the outlines a carved, calligraphic finish rather than a blunt slab feel. Uppercase proportions are broad with generous sidebearings, while lowercase forms are sturdy and compact, with a two-storey g and a distinctly weighted, oldstyle-flavored figure set. Overall spacing and rhythm read as steady and formal, with crisp joins and a strong black presence in text.
It performs well in headlines and subheads where contrast and serif detail can be appreciated, and it can also support short-to-medium passages in editorial or book contexts when a strong, traditional typographic color is desired. The assertive weight and formal construction also make it suitable for heritage-leaning branding, invitations, and display typography that aims for gravitas.
The tone is traditional and editorial, projecting authority and refinement. Its high-contrast detailing and confident weight suggest a voice suited to established institutions, print-forward design, and classic literature rather than casual or playful settings.
The design appears intended as a conventional, high-contrast serif with a robust presence, balancing classic proportions with a darker, more emphatic color. It aims to deliver a refined, print-like texture while keeping letterforms familiar and highly legible in typical editorial settings.
The numerals show noticeable variation in widths and a traditional, text-oriented feel, matching the serifed, high-contrast construction of the letters. In sample text, the font maintains a strong color and clear word shapes, with punctuation and capitals contributing a stately, headline-ready character.
